Job Summary and Qualifications

Prepares patients, collects relevant information for completion of procedures.
Performs all CT procedures, Able to learn and/or perform MRI Exams
Observant of patients’ conditions.
Practices and enforces radiation safety as described in federal standards, utilizing ALARA policy.
Adheres to all appropriate hospital and regulatory policies and assists in maintaining accreditation.
Understands and operates electronic information systems.
Compiles appropriate records to expedite results.
Administers contrast media as required.
Participates in continuing education activities to expand/enhance knowledge of CT and to meet the continuing education requirements of the ARRT.
Takes call after regular hours as assigned.
Maintains appropriate supplies.
Assures primary area is clean and organized. Assists in other areas of the department when not needed in primary area. Performs clerical and transport duties as needed.

What qualifications you will need:

EXPERIENCE

Required:

Experience as a Radiologic Technologist.
Preferred:
One year dedicated CT experience.

EDUCATION

Required:

Graduate of accredited school of Radiologic Technology.

LICENSE/CERTIFICATION

Required:

ARRT registered.

Required:

CT Registry within 12 months of employment and BLS within 90 days of employment.
